The following are some of the services that are offered by the LGBT Resource Center. Our staff and volunteers will be happy to answer any questions you might have. Stop by and visit us!

  • Space for all individuals -- come and chat with friends, relax in our library/activity room, or access your email via the internet at the student workstation.
  • Information and referrals -- we provide information on campus events and resources.
  • Educational, cultural and social events -- check out our quarterly calendar to see what campus events interest you.
  • LGBT queer and gender academic resources -- we have listings of courses offered at UCSD.
  • LGBT Speakers Bureau -- trained students, staff, and faculty are available to speak to your group or organization. Keep an eye on our calendar for upcoming trainings or email us if you are interested in becoming a speaker.
  • The Resource Center is also the home to the David Bohnett Wireless CyberCenter at UCSD, providing the community computing resources to further meet the primary academic mission of the university.

In addition to possessing a lending library, video library, and other reference/resource materials, the LGBT Resource Center serves as the repository for the Lesbian Gay Bisexual Transgender Campus Historical Collection and Project at the University of California, San Diego. The collection includes over 2,000 pages and items, which collectively chronicles the experiences and activities of the LGBT/queer campus community over more than two decades. All members of campus community and the public may access the collection within the LGBT Resource Center.

The LGBT Campus Historical Collection and Project at UCSD was compiled over two years by Scott Heath (class of 2000) with the generous support of many individuals and organizations and was dedicated at the 2000 Rainbow Graduation.
